Understanding Encrypted Connections
When it comes to uploading files over the internet, it's crucial to understand the concept of encrypted connections. An encrypted connection, also known as a secure socket layer (SSL) or transport layer security (TLS) connection, is a method of protecting data in transit from unauthorized access. This type of connection uses algorithms to scramble the data, making it unreadable to anyone who intercepts it.
Benefits of Encrypted Connections
- Data protection: Encrypted connections protect your files from being intercepted and accessed by unauthorized parties.
- Compliance: Using encrypted connections helps you comply with data protection regulations, such as GDPR and HIPAA.
- Trust: Encrypted connections build trust with your customers and partners, as they know that their data is being handled securely.
